About Company: Ossus Biorenewables Private Limited is a bioenergy company based out of IKP Eden, Koramangala, Bangalore. We are developing solutions to turn wastewater into an asset. Our flagship technology is currently being prototyped and is based on a state-of-the-art microbial electrolysis process for enervating biohydrogen and chemicals.
